Clicking the thread title should take you to where to wherever you last read to, but if it doesn't, clicking the date of the last post (under the username) will take you to the end of the thread.

image.png

 

The ad load time has been a pain point for me as well. I can't see anything from my end that can speed it up, but I'll reach out to the network and see if there's anything they can do to improve it. The Twitter links are embedded and unavoidable. It's set up so that they don't load until you scroll to them. It can be annoying in threads with many tweets shared, but the alternative would be to have them all load with the page, which will load that page to a crawl, due to the type of content it is.
